Output 12e124dd5be1632c001e4262c00a19cebe2f76a51ca77a8461eb99243aa5db79:1

value
668591
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3fc60cfb8b24fecf1af2bcf754d4ada6d643d297 OP_EQUALVERIFY OP_CHECKSIG
address
16pCptdMLk9nDdcevouRfd2uNEx7bA6aHW
transaction
12e124dd5be1632c001e4262c00a19cebe2f76a51ca77a8461eb99243aa5db79
confirmations
457685
spent
true